The Origin and Evolution of Beadboard in Kitchen Design
Beadboard emerged in the late 19th century as a practical solution for covering walls in farmhouse kitchens and coastal cottages. Before modern paints and wallcoverings, narrow beadboard planks were installed horizontally or vertically to create a smooth, washable surface that could withstand moisture and daily wear. The signature grooves, or "beads," provided a simple yet effective way to add depth and character while maintaining a clean, hygienic finish. Over time, cabinetry manufacturers adapted this aesthetic, transforming beadboard from a wall treatment into a distinctive cabinet door style that preserves the historic appeal while meeting modern functional standards.
Design Characteristics and Visual Appeal
What sets beadboard kitchen cabinets apart is their understated textural detail. The linear grooves, typically spaced evenly and running vertically, create a play of light and shadow that adds depth without overwhelming the space. This design works across a range of styles, from farmhouse and transitional to coastal and cottage-inspired kitchens. Available in both raised and recessed configurations, beadboard doors can feature Shaker-style simplicity or incorporate glass inserts for a more open, airy feel. The neutral, versatile profile allows for easy pairing with painted trim, natural wood accents, or sleek modern hardware.

Practical Benefits and Durability Considerations
Beyond aesthetics, beadboard kitchen cabinets offer practical advantages that appeal to everyday homeowners. The structured surface can help conceal minor wall imperfections and provides a stable base for painted finishes, which tend to hide wear better than glossy laminates. When crafted from durable materials such as MDF or solid wood with quality finishes, these cabinets resist moisture and humidity, making them suitable for kitchen environments. Regular cleaning with a soft cloth and mild detergent preserves the appearance, while periodic checks of hinges and seals ensure long-term functionality.
Material Choices and Customization Options
Manufacturers typically produce beadboard kitchen cabinets using engineered wood, medium-density fiberboard, or solid hardwood, each offering distinct performance characteristics. Engineered options provide consistent dimensions and reduced expansion risk, while solid wood delivers authentic grain and premium longevity. Customization extends to profile depth, groove spacing, panel layout, and finish, allowing homeowners to specify anything from subtle, narrow grooves to bold, deeply shadowed textures. These tailored options ensure beadboard cabinetry can be adapted to both compact galley kitchens and expansive chef-style layouts.
Integrating Beadboard with Modern Kitchen Elements
One common misconception is that beadboard kitchen cabinets belong only in traditional spaces, yet thoughtful styling bridges classic and contemporary design. Pairing beadboard with matte black hardware, quartz countertops, and streamlined appliances can produce a refined, modern farmhouse aesthetic. Contrasting materials such as marble backsplashes, metal light fixtures, or bold accent walls prevent the look from feeling dated. Layered lighting, particularly with under-cabinet LED strips or pendant fixtures, highlights the cabinet texture and elevates the overall ambience.
